Places To Explore In The Arctic Region

The North Pole

Visit the most Northerly point on Earth and encounter the frozen Arctic Ocean's unique wildernessย and wildlife.

The Arctic

Explore the Arctic region from Svalbard and Greenland to the Northwest Passage. Learn about the differences in each of the Arctic's unique locations.

The Northwest Passage

Explore the legendary Sea Route, which connects the Atlantic and Pacific Oceans with its rich history of exploration, captivating scenery and rare Arctic wildlife.

Svalbard & Spitsbergen

One of the best places on Earth to see polar bears and Arctic wildlife, Svalbard attracts wildlife lovers from all over the globe to witness its abundant nature.ย 

Places To Explore In The Antarctic Region

Antarctica

Follow in the footsteps of explorers and encounter the world's 7th and most remote continent with diverse wildlife, including penguins, whales, seals and birds.

South Georgia

Explore the remote sub-Antarctic Island of South Georgia, home to some of the largest concentrations of wildlife on the planet, including over 400,000 King Penguins.

The South Pole

Be one of the few people to have ever reached the most southerly point on Earth on an adventurous expedition by plane to reach the South Pole.
